UTNianos

Versión completa: Especializaciones en programación.
Actualmente estas viendo una versión simplificada de nuestro contenido. Ver la versión completa con el formato correcto.
Páginas: 1 2
Hola, no se me ocurre otro titulo. Lo que quiero saber yo es de cuantas cosas se puede trabajar como programador, estuve buscando y las mas comunes que veo son:
-Aplicaciones web
-Videojuegos
-Aplicaciones móviles

Pero me gustaria saber que mas cosas se pueden hacer.

Tambien quisiera en que sectores mas se puede trabajar, a parte de:
-Sector de Tecnología
-Sector financiero
-Sector Industrial (este lo vi, pero no tengo ni idea de que puede trabajar un programador en industrias)
-Sector de Servicios (tampoco tengo mucha idea)

Antes de empezar a trabajar quiero ver que lado me atrae mas, por ahora aplicaciones web o videojuegos. el sector de tecnologia, pero tampoco descarto el sector financiero. Si me pueden ayudar agradecido estoy ya que quiero empezar a laburar cuanto antes pero tampoco quiero empezar sin saber que me gusta mas =(
(17-09-2013 03:32)manu222 escribió: [ -> ]Hola, no se me ocurre otro titulo. Lo que quiero saber yo es de cuantas cosas se puede trabajar como programador, estuve buscando y las mas comunes que veo son:
-Aplicaciones web
-Videojuegos
-Aplicaciones móviles

Pero me gustaria saber que mas cosas se pueden hacer.

Tambien quisiera en que sectores mas se puede trabajar, a parte de:
-Sector de Tecnología
-Sector financiero
-Sector Industrial (este lo vi, pero no tengo ni idea de que puede trabajar un programador en industrias)
-Sector de Servicios (tampoco tengo mucha idea)

Antes de empezar a trabajar quiero ver que lado me atrae mas, por ahora aplicaciones web o videojuegos. el sector de tecnologia, pero tampoco descarto el sector financiero. Si me pueden ayudar agradecido estoy ya que quiero empezar a laburar cuanto antes pero tampoco quiero empezar sin saber que me gusta mas =(


solo quieres ser programador ?

yo creo que todo comparte lo que llamas "sector tecnología" no te hagas un embole dividiéndolo en varias ramas xD
programar sistemas , aplicaciones etc que te pidan
Gracias por contestar. Jaja bueno, pero entonces trabajando 1 año en aplicaciones web corre como experiencia para programar en aplicaciones moviles por ejemplo? Otro ejemplo, si empiezo en videojuegos y luego me doy cuenta que me gusta mas nose aplicaciones web o programar en una automotriz, esa experiencia en videojuegos cuenta? o es como empezar desde cero? Esa sería mi duda. Si trabajar de una cosa sirve para otra o siempre se empieza de cero.

Si, por ahora solo quiero ser programador.
(18-09-2013 01:01)manu222 escribió: [ -> ]Gracias por contestar. Jaja bueno, pero entonces trabajando 1 año en aplicaciones web corre como experiencia para programar en aplicaciones moviles por ejemplo? Otro ejemplo, si empiezo en videojuegos y luego me doy cuenta que me gusta mas nose aplicaciones web o programar en una automotriz, esa experiencia en videojuegos cuenta? o es como empezar desde cero? Esa sería mi duda. Si trabajar de una cosa sirve para otra o siempre se empieza de cero.

Si, por ahora solo quiero ser programador.

te contesto esto bajo mi nula experiencia laboral y mis pocos conocimientos

para mi aplicaciones web y móviles es diferente por ende si te pasas de una a otra seria como empezar casi de 0
pero toda experiencia te sirve
Desde mi experiencia, te diría lo siguiente:
Preocupate por lenguajes y paradigmas si querés programar. No por "lo que vayas a programar". En el fondo son lo mismo. Ponele: las apps de Android se hacen en Java, que también se usa para cualquier otro sistema de información (ej: para un banco, una empresa petrolera o lo que sea). Esta comparación es en la base, si conocés cómo programar en Java, en este caso, con un tiempo de adaptarte a frameworks o librerías propias de cada una, más algunos chiches más, pasás de una a otra tranquilamente.
Muchas gracias. te hago un pregunta, Java vendria a ser el lenguaje que sirve para mas sistemas de informacion que los demas? Digo porque PHP dicen que sirve mas para web, abap y cobol es muy limitado, c++ para videojuegos. no me queda claro si en .net se puede hacer la misma cantidad que con java (aunque supongo que no ya que solo se maneja en microsoft pero ni idea si es impedimento para hacer cualquier tipo de aplicacion). O digamos que con muchos lenguajes se puede hacer de todo?
eso es todo muy relativo y cambiante, a lo largo del tiempo..


como reco, no te metas en java, pero hay gente que te va a decir "metete en java, es lo mas"

=P
Lo decis porque no le ves tan buen futuro? Porque cada vez hay mas gente desarrollando en java? O por otra razon?
Sobre en que rama laburar... videojuegos y aplicaciones generales son dos mundos diferentes. En uno laburas en bajo nivel, haciendo todo para que el personaje se mueva rapido, y en el otro laburas a mas alto nivel, viendo que necesita el cliente en particular e implementandolo.

Sobre cambiar, entre movil y web, dependiendo bien que hagas, no es tan loco el traspaso. Yo labure casi siempre web, y cuando quise meterme en android fue ver como se hacian un par de cosas ahi y ya. Eso de que si cambias de lenguaje perdes toda la experiencia es muy muy relativo. Muchas cosas se hacen de la misma forma, solo tenes que ver como (manejo de listas, algunos patrones y buenas practicas, etc). Yo ya voy por mi 5to lenguaje a nivel laburo (sin contar SQL, html y esas cosas) y a esta altura lo que me pasa todo el tiempo es que digo "esto lo haria asi... como se hace en Ruby?", pero esta bastante lejos de arrancar de cero. En mi caso, llevo 7 años casi laburando en desarrollo, asi que quedate tranquilo =P.

Respecto de java, hay un topic donde hablabamos de eso... mi vision y la de muchos es que se volvio "lento" para laburar. Con otros lenguajes haces cosas en dos minutos y con java te llevan dias. Eso no quita que sea un buen lenguaje para arrancar a laburar, ya que hay mucha demanda, mucha gente capacitada, etc. Igualmente, yo arranque en .NET y te recomiendo mirar primero por ahi. Eso de que solo funciona en entornos windows es muy relativo, vos subis algo a un server con windows y no te importa si la gente accede desde linux, windows, mac, etc.

Exitos!
(19-09-2013 15:45)Adriano escribió: [ -> ]Sobre en que rama laburar... videojuegos y aplicaciones generales son dos mundos diferentes. En uno laburas en bajo nivel, haciendo todo para que el personaje se mueva rapido, y en el otro laburas a mas alto nivel, viendo que necesita el cliente en particular e implementandolo.

Sobre cambiar, entre movil y web, dependiendo bien que hagas, no es tan loco el traspaso. Yo labure casi siempre web, y cuando quise meterme en android fue ver como se hacian un par de cosas ahi y ya. Eso de que si cambias de lenguaje perdes toda la experiencia es muy muy relativo. Muchas cosas se hacen de la misma forma, solo tenes que ver como (manejo de listas, algunos patrones y buenas practicas, etc). Yo ya voy por mi 5to lenguaje a nivel laburo (sin contar SQL, html y esas cosas) y a esta altura lo que me pasa todo el tiempo es que digo "esto lo haria asi... como se hace en Ruby?", pero esta bastante lejos de arrancar de cero. En mi caso, llevo 7 años casi laburando en desarrollo, asi que quedate tranquilo =P.

Buenisimo, entonces arranco tranqui y veo para donde me va llevando el camino =P

(19-09-2013 15:45)Adriano escribió: [ -> ]Respecto de java, hay un topic donde hablabamos de eso... mi vision y la de muchos es que se volvio "lento" para laburar. Con otros lenguajes haces cosas en dos minutos y con java te llevan dias. Eso no quita que sea un buen lenguaje para arrancar a laburar, ya que hay mucha demanda, mucha gente capacitada, etc. Igualmente, yo arranque en .NET y te recomiendo mirar primero por ahi. Eso de que solo funciona en entornos windows es muy relativo, vos subis algo a un server con windows y no te importa si la gente accede desde linux, windows, mac, etc.

Exitos!

Gracias. Me convenciste para arrancar en .NET =)

Muchas gracias a todos por las respuestas!
Pensaba que ya estaba decidido de con que empezar pero despues de investigar un poco me entro la duda. Me esta interesando empezar con Ruby, es dificil conseguir el primer laburo con este sin tener experiencia? No veo mucha oferta de laburo. O primero me mando con .NET y hago el pase? Tambien estoy considerando Python, pero lo mismo de que no veo mucho trabajo.


Ruby on rails y Python me interesan porque dicen que tienen mucho futuro. Ruby porque es muy bueno para el desarrollo Web y Python por si no quiero seguir ahi y lei que se tiene mas facilidad que el primero para cualquier tipo de aplicacion no web.
(08-10-2013 03:26)manu222 escribió: [ -> ]Pensaba que ya estaba decidido de con que empezar pero despues de investigar un poco me entro la duda. Me esta interesando empezar con Ruby, es dificil conseguir el primer laburo con este sin tener experiencia? No veo mucha oferta de laburo. O primero me mando con .NET y hago el pase? Tambien estoy considerando Python, pero lo mismo de que no veo mucho trabajo.


Ruby on rails y Python me interesan porque dicen que tienen mucho futuro. Ruby porque es muy bueno para el desarrollo Web y Python por si no quiero seguir ahi y lei que se tiene mas facilidad que el primero para cualquier tipo de aplicacion no web.

Afortunadamente, es difícil que no haya laburo para programadores (pese a que este año y el que viene el panorama esté un toque más ajustado).
Muchas empresas hasta te capacitan para que puedas programar, y no te va a sorprender cruzarte con gente que no es de sistemas, haciendo trabajo de sistemas.

Para Python lo último que sé es que la semana pasada un compañero de cursada dijo que buscaban gente en su proyecto.. así que es una buena señal jaja.
Yo programo en ABAP (lenguaje de SAP)... la esclavizadora consultora para la que trabajo me capacitó hace 3 años en el mismo y, hasta el momento, no tuve problemas al buscar trabajo en otros lados (pese a no haber cambiado, las entrevistas eran muy positivas).

En términos generales hay muy buena oferta para sistemas, y lugares donde te capacitan de manera gratuita con tal de saber que cuentan con vos.
El lenguaje para iniciar no sabría decirte.. .NET y toda la rama web son opciones buenas, con oferta hasta para gente sin experiencia.

Saludos!
Gracias! Estoy pensando que es mejor arrancar en .NET, de Ruby, que es la que mas me interesa, solo veo ofertas para gente con experiencia, no encuentro nada para Jr. Debe ser jodido encontrar sin experiencia. Python lo veo mejor y se encuentra algunas pocas para juniors pero me estoy inclinando mas para el lado de Web y para eso me meto primero en .NET antes que Python, y luego Ruby. Mi dilema de si meterme en una y luego pasar a otra es porque me queda la duda si uno se debe espefcializar o aprender varios, pense que especializandote en algo se ganaria mejor y se tendrian mas ventajas, pero como dijeron, esto es muy cambiante y no me sirve de mucho enfocarme al 100% en algo si en el futuro puyede caer de repente. Creo que es mas importante aprender varios y enfocarse mas en uno, a esa conclusion llegue, nose si estoy en lo correcto o estoy muy equivocado =P
Esta lista es la de la comunidad Ruby de Latinoamérica, y suelen haber ofertas de laburo, además de material, cursos y eso: https://groups.google.com/forum/#!forum/rubysur
Ruby tambien puede ser una buena opcion para arrancar. Particularmente, recien me estoy metiendo con el lenguaje y me esta costando mas de lo que pense. Estoy acostumbrado a .NET o Java que tienen muchas mas herramientas (tipo entornos de desarrollo, debugguers, etc). Pero parece bastante interesante
Páginas: 1 2
URLs de referencia